Inside Kali Linux | Exploring Top Ethical Hacking Tools for Beginners (2025 Guide)
Discover what makes Kali Linux the go-to OS for cybersecurity. Explore real ethical hacking tools like Nmap, Metasploit & Wireshark. Start your journey into penetration testing in 2025 with hands-on insights.

Table of Contents
- What Is Kali Linux and Why Is It Popular Among Hackers?
- Why I Chose Kali Linux for My Cybersecurity Journey
- Top Tools I Explored in Kali Linux
- How I Used Kali Linux for Learning Ethical Hacking
- What Makes Kali Linux Unique for Cybersecurity Students?
- Challenges I Faced While Exploring Kali Linux
- Best Practices for Beginners Using Kali Linux
- Career Benefits of Learning Kali Linux
- Conclusion
- Frequently Asked Questions (FAQs)
If you've ever wondered how ethical hackers use Kali Linux, this blog takes you inside a hands-on journey through its most powerful tools. I explored penetration testing, network analysis, and digital forensics—all using a single operating system designed for cybersecurity professionals.
What Is Kali Linux and Why Is It Popular Among Hackers?
Kali Linux is a Debian-based Linux distribution specially crafted for penetration testing, ethical hacking, and security auditing. It comes preloaded with over 600 tools that cover a range of security tasks including:
-
Vulnerability scanning
-
Password attacks
-
Wireless sniffing
-
Web app testing
-
Reverse engineering
Developed and maintained by Offensive Security, Kali Linux is the preferred OS for professionals preparing for certifications like OSCP, CEH, and CPT.
Why I Chose Kali Linux for My Cybersecurity Journey
When starting out, I needed a platform that:
-
Had pre-installed tools for ethical hacking
-
Was free and open-source
-
Offered extensive community support
-
Could run on a virtual machine or live USB
Kali Linux checked every box. Within minutes of installing it on VirtualBox, I had access to industry-grade hacker tools used by real penetration testers.
Top Tools I Explored in Kali Linux
Here are three key tools I used during my journey and what I discovered about each:
Tool Name | Purpose | My Experience |
---|---|---|
Nmap | Network scanning & mapping | Scanned all devices on my Wi-Fi and found open ports. |
Metasploit Framework | Exploitation toolkit | Simulated real-world vulnerabilities and learned how payloads work. |
Wireshark | Packet analyzer | Captured packets and analyzed unsecured traffic in real time. |
These tools helped me understand real attack vectors and how to defend against them.
How I Used Kali Linux for Learning Ethical Hacking
Step 1: Set Up a Virtual Lab
I created a virtual lab using Kali Linux + Metasploitable2 to practice safely without affecting my real system.
Step 2: Followed Capture the Flag (CTF) Challenges
Sites like TryHackMe and Hack The Box let me apply Kali tools in real-world scenarios.
Step 3: Practiced Scanning and Exploitation
-
Ran Nmap scans on targets
-
Identified services like Apache, SSH, and FTP
-
Used Metasploit to test known exploits
What Makes Kali Linux Unique for Cybersecurity Students?
Tool Integration
Everything is neatly organized in the menu by categories like:
-
Information Gathering
-
Vulnerability Analysis
-
Exploitation Tools
-
Sniffing & Spoofing
-
Password Attacks
Constant Updates
Tools are regularly updated, ensuring compatibility with the latest exploits and vulnerabilities.
Customizability
I was able to build a customized Kali image using Kali Linux ISO Builder, perfect for focused learning.
Challenges I Faced While Exploring Kali Linux
-
Understanding the Linux terminal and shell commands
-
Decoding technical outputs from tools like Wireshark
-
Avoiding legal/ethical mistakes while practicing in real environments
These were overcome by studying documentation, joining cybersecurity forums, and following ethical hacking courses.
Best Practices for Beginners Using Kali Linux
1. Always Use a Safe Lab Environment
Never run Kali tools on a public network or against unauthorized systems.
2. Learn Basic Linux Commands First
Mastering commands like ifconfig
, netstat
, and grep
improves your workflow dramatically.
3. Use Guided Learning Platforms
Sites like WebAsha Technologies offer structured courses on OSCP, CEH, and Linux security, making your learning path easier and safer.
Career Benefits of Learning Kali Linux
Learning Kali Linux opens doors to roles like:
-
Penetration Tester
-
Red Team Analyst
-
SOC Analyst
-
Ethical Hacker
-
Cybersecurity Consultant
These positions are in high demand in 2025, with salaries starting at ₹6–12 LPA and growing with experience.
Conclusion
Kali Linux is more than just an OS—it’s a launchpad for aspiring cybersecurity professionals. From scanning networks to exploiting vulnerabilities (ethically), my journey with Kali Linux taught me how real-world hackers think and act. If you're serious about cybersecurity, take the leap, build a lab, and dive into Kali Linux. Your future in ethical hacking could begin right here.
FAQs
What is Kali Linux used for in ethical hacking?
Kali Linux is used for penetration testing, vulnerability scanning, and digital forensics. It includes pre-installed tools that help ethical hackers simulate and defend against cyberattacks.
Is Kali Linux good for beginners in cybersecurity?
Yes, Kali Linux is ideal for beginners as it offers a wide range of ethical hacking tools and can be used in virtual labs to practice safely.
Which tools come pre-installed in Kali Linux?
Kali Linux includes tools like Nmap, Metasploit, Wireshark, Burp Suite, John the Ripper, Hydra, and Aircrack-ng, among many others.
Can I learn ethical hacking using Kali Linux without coding knowledge?
You can start with minimal coding knowledge, but understanding scripting languages like Bash, Python, or PowerShell is beneficial for advanced tasks.
Do I need a powerful computer to run Kali Linux?
No, Kali Linux can run on modest systems. A system with 4–8 GB RAM and virtualization support is sufficient for most learning purposes.
Is Kali Linux legal to use?
Yes, Kali Linux is legal to use for educational and authorized penetration testing. Unauthorized scanning or attacks are illegal and unethical.
Can I install Kali Linux on Windows?
Yes, Kali Linux can be installed using VirtualBox, VMware, or Windows Subsystem for Linux (WSL) on Windows machines.
What are the best Kali Linux tools for network scanning?
Nmap, Netdiscover, and Wireshark are top tools for identifying hosts, services, and analyzing traffic within a network.
How do I practice with Kali Linux safely?
Use a virtual lab environment such as Metasploitable2 or DVWA to simulate vulnerabilities without risking live systems.
What is Metasploit in Kali Linux?
Metasploit is a powerful framework in Kali Linux used for developing and executing exploits against vulnerable systems.
Is Kali Linux better than Parrot OS for hacking?
Both are excellent, but Kali is more widely used for penetration testing and offers extensive support from the Offensive Security community.
How can I update Kali Linux tools?
You can update tools using commands like sudo apt update
and sudo apt upgrade
to get the latest versions.
What is the difference between Kali Linux and Ubuntu?
Kali is specialized for cybersecurity, while Ubuntu is a general-purpose OS. Kali comes with pre-installed security tools.
Can I run Kali Linux on a USB drive?
Yes, Kali Linux supports live booting from USB, allowing you to use it without installing on your system.
Is learning Kali Linux enough to become an ethical hacker?
Kali Linux is a great starting point, but becoming an ethical hacker requires understanding networks, systems, scripting, and attack methodologies.
What are the prerequisites to learn Kali Linux?
Basic knowledge of Linux commands, networking, and cybersecurity concepts is recommended before diving into Kali Linux.
Can I use Kali Linux for web app testing?
Yes, tools like Burp Suite and OWASP ZAP in Kali Linux are ideal for testing web application vulnerabilities.
How often is Kali Linux updated?
Kali Linux receives frequent updates with tool upgrades and OS improvements, usually multiple times a year.
What certifications can I prepare for using Kali Linux?
You can prepare for OSCP, CEH, CompTIA Security+, and other penetration testing and ethical hacking certifications.
Where can I find tutorials for Kali Linux?
You can find Kali Linux tutorials on YouTube, cybersecurity blogs, forums like Reddit and GitHub, and training institutes like Ethical Hacking Training Institute.
Is Kali Linux free to use?
Yes, Kali Linux is completely free and open-source under the GNU GPL license.
What are some risks of using Kali Linux improperly?
Improper or unauthorized use can lead to legal consequences. Always practice ethical hacking in controlled environments.
How can I back up my Kali Linux configurations?
You can use tools like rsync
, dd
, or cloud-based GitHub repositories to back up configs and scripts.
What are sniffing tools in Kali Linux?
Sniffing tools like Wireshark and tcpdump allow you to capture and analyze network packets for security assessment.
Can Kali Linux be used for wireless attacks?
Yes, tools like Aircrack-ng and Reaver are used to test Wi-Fi network security, provided it’s done in a legal environment.
How much RAM is recommended for Kali Linux?
At least 4 GB is recommended for basic tasks, while 8 GB or more is preferred for advanced penetration testing.
What desktop environments are supported in Kali Linux?
Kali supports XFCE (default), GNOME, KDE Plasma, and others depending on your preference and system capabilities.
Can I dual boot Kali Linux with Windows?
Yes, dual booting is possible, but you should be careful during installation and understand disk partitioning.
What’s the difference between Kali Linux Full and Light images?
The Full version includes all tools, while the Light version is minimal for quick installations or advanced customization.
Does Kali Linux support ARM devices like Raspberry Pi?
Yes, there are ARM versions of Kali Linux that run on devices like Raspberry Pi for portable testing labs.